QUOTE(Ulysses @ Mar 4 2012, 06:15 PM)
depend on its condition.  hmm.gif


Added on March 4, 2012, 6:20 pmhi..i want to ask something about logitech mouse & keyboard...
i want to buy wireless kb/mouse, but a bit confuse...at their website, they stated this

1) Unifying (nano receiver)
2) Bluetooth
3) Wireless
4) Advanced 2.4ghz wireless
from all that 4, so which one is good?

hmm.gif
*
the wireless is either 2.4Ghz or advanced 2.4Ghz band, the advanced is said to be more reliable as it doesnt interfere with other 2.4Ghz band devices, logitech's wireless keyboards and mice using the nano receiver is either unifying or else, if unifying, that means the receiver will accept other compatible unifying keyboards/mice to one common receiver, the non-unifying means one receiver one device, the bluetooth i think no need explain right? laugh.gif
